Steps:

  1. Select files in the file list. Say the selection contains five files (a, b, c, d and e in the desktop).

  2. Ctrl-c to copy the selection.

  3. Ctrl-v to paste it in a text area, for example in a plain text opened with gedit.

Actual result:

The files list is pasted in the inverse order:

/home/moi/Bureau/e
/home/moi/Bureau/d
/home/moi/Bureau/c
/home/moi/Bureau/b
/home/moi/Bureau/a

Expected result:

Files pasted in the same order than they appear in SpaceFM:

/home/moi/Bureau/a
/home/moi/Bureau/b
/home/moi/Bureau/c
/home/moi/Bureau/d
/home/moi/Bureau/e
